Lottery names frequently perform well when a reward word leads the name: Gold Point, Prize Castle, Fortune Wave, or Bounty Sky. This mirrors real-world gaming language where the payoff—not the mechanics—is the main emotional hook.
A name like Lucky Matrix or Magic Palace feels more usable than something overly chaotic because it mixes excitement with structure. In lottery naming, pairing a luck word with a stable noun helps the brand feel like a real operator rather than a novelty game.
Words such as quick, rapid, instant, pick, draw, and win are common in lottery-adjacent branding because they suggest frequent participation and fast outcomes. Combinations like Rapid Draw or Quick Fortune fit the category better than abstract names with no gaming signal.
Names that imply guaranteed riches can create trust issues in this niche. Instead of absolute claims, use suggestive language like fate, chance, wonder, miracle, or charm to capture the lottery feeling without sounding deceptive.
Many lottery businesses appear on storefronts, tickets, kiosks, or app icons, so short names with strong visual separation work best. Two compact words like Spark Gold or Epic Lucky are easier to scan than long fantasy-style names with multiple syllables or unusual spellings.

Lottery business names work best when they capture anticipation, luck, and the emotional spike of a possible win without sounding shady or overly gimmicky. In this niche, customers respond to words tied to chance and reward—terms like lucky, fate, gold, jackpot, draw, prize, and fortune—because they instantly signal what the business is about. Strong names often pair those ideas with energetic or trustworthy structures, such as Lucky Point, Gold Draw, Fortune Palace, or Rapid Win, creating a balance between excitement and legitimacy that matters in any lottery-related brand. What makes this category different from other sports and recreation naming is the need to suggest thrill while still feeling credible, official, and easy to remember. Lottery brands often lean on bright, optimistic imagery—spark, magic, galaxy, wonder, harvest, bliss—but the strongest names avoid sounding like fantasy games with no real-world payout. Short two-word combinations, prize-oriented compounds, and names that imply speed or repeated play are especially effective for lottery retailers, sweepstakes concepts, draw platforms, and number-based gaming businesses. Customers expect a name that feels lucky, upbeat, and prize-driven, but also clear enough to trust with their money.
